Department: Production
Reports to: Sr. Manager - Production
Does this job have supervisory responsibilities? Yes Number of reports: 40 Plus
Job Titles of reports: Associates Region of reports: Jamnagar
Position Summary:
Actively involved in production man power handling, timely execution of jobs, ensure achieve daily production targets & ensure product must meet quality criteria, actively involved in store management activity.
Roles and Responsibilities :
Ensure smooth execution of production through effective planning, coordination, communication, delegation, supervision, training, hand holding and resolution of technical issues being faced in day to day activities.
Participate in periodical review meetings with reporting manager and HOD.
Monitor process performance data and carry out data analysis for non-achievement of targets and initiate suitable corrective actions for sustainable improvements.
Maintain records of production as required by organization & ensure maintenance of machines.
Ensure to follow safe work practices.
Maintain Die, Tools & Machine maintenance history card as per ISO standard.
Maintain material movement (receiving and submission) activity with Store department and it should be as per daily plan.
Ensure to achieve Production as per production plan and priorities.
Ensure to quality of product match with the drawing specification.
Strictly adhere with production plan.
Managing Inventory control and On-Time Delivery (OTD).
To ensure proper housekeeping in the department.
To ensure the all workmen’s wear personal protective equipment (PPE) while at work.
To ensure the all workmen’s follow the Environment, Health & Safety policy.
Maintain a report of daily production and file it into the main database. This data is used by manager to make production decisions.
Knowledge of defects in Press parts expert to resolve.
Skills & Abilities Required:
Basic knowledge of Excel, Word, Power point and SAP. Basic knowledge of hardware spare parts identification & its uses. knowledge of OEE, SMED, 5 “S”, MTPT, OTD, HIRA, SQDC etc. Orthographic drawing, symbols & its standard identification skill. Team player and able to build and maintain relationships with team. Preferred skills- Communication, Delegation, People Management, Leadership, Analytical, Decision making. Knowledge: Tool Setting, Machine operation (Press Shop), Awareness of requirements of ISO 9001:2015 QMS, ISO 45001:2018, ISO 14001:2015. Willing to work on the shop floor departments. Workable English Communication skills (Writing /Speaking) Good problem-solving skill Good Analytical skill Quick decision maker Good drawing reading and GD & T skill.

Education Qualification & Experience required:
Bachlor in Mechanical Engineering with minimum 4 years of experience Preferred experience of working in an Automotive/Architectural hardware industries Team handling experience will be preferred highly.
